COMMUNITY WORKER
The Coalition for the Success of African-Caribbean Youth is looking for a community worker with an MSW or BSW with relevant experience or equivalent qualifications. We require a well qualified individual to be responsible for the development of a new project.
Applicants should possess previous experience with African-Caribbean youth and their families and demonstrate initiative and flexibility. We are looking for a creative self-starter with good communication and interpersonal skills. Experience in advocacy and community development in situations of oppression is essential as is experience in or knowledge of the Ontario school system. Applicants will need to give evidence of their ability to connect with and build capacity in community organizations. The position requires your own transportation and relevant computer skills and is for one year with the possibility of renewal. It is a 35 hour/week position with a salary of $50 000 - $57 500.
